                                                                The Ugly Duckling

Once upon a time, in the middle of green trees, there was a small farm. On this farm lived happy animals. Near a pond at the edge of the farm, a mother duck was patiently waiting for her eggs to hatch in her nest.

One sunny morning, the eggs began to crack one by one. Tiny, yellow-feathered ducklings popped out and greeted the world with cheerful “chirp chirp” sounds.
The mother duck looked at them lovingly.

But one egg hadn’t cracked yet.
This egg was much bigger than the others.

The mother duck became a little worried:
“Why is this egg so big?” she wondered.

Finally, the big egg cracked, too. Out came a big baby bird with gray feathers and a very different look.
He didn’t look cute and yellow like the others.

The other ducklings were surprised when they saw him, and they started to laugh:
“What a strange-looking bird!”
“How ugly he is!” they said.

The mother duck loved her baby very much, but it made her sad that everyone was making fun of him.

The other animals on the farm also left the ugly duckling out:
“You can’t even be a duck!” they shouted.

The ugly duckling was very sad.
As days passed, he felt more and more lonely.
One day, he couldn’t take it anymore and ran away from the farm.

He walked and walked into the forest...

There, he met many different animals — sparrows, rabbits, hedgehogs...
But they all laughed at him too:

“Who are you supposed to be?”
“What a weird creature!”

The ugly duckling took shelter in a swamp.
He met some wild ducks there, but they didn’t want him either.

Winter was coming.
The weather turned cold, and the ponds froze over.
The ugly duckling was freezing and hungry.
Sometimes he ate a few crumbs left by kind farmers.

After a cold and lonely winter, spring finally arrived.
Flowers bloomed, and the sun came out.

One morning, the ugly duckling, now very weak, came to a pond.
He leaned over the water and saw his reflection.
He couldn’t believe his eyes!

The gray, ugly baby was gone.
In his place was a magnificent swan with elegant, snow-white feathers!

Just then, a few swans were swimming on the pond.
They gracefully glided toward him and nodded their heads with love.

The ugly duckling was now one of them.
He spread his wings with confidence and swam gently across the lake.

No one laughed at him anymore.
Everyone watched him with admiration.

The ugly duckling had discovered his true identity and beauty.
From that day on, he lived a life full of love.
And he never judged anyone by their appearance again.

Because true beauty appears with patience and time.

And he lived happily ever after.
